Future ocean warming may cause large reductions in Prochlorococcus biomass and productivity

www.nature.com/articles/s41...
Future ocean warming may cause large reductions in Prochlorococcus biomass and productivity - Nature Microbiology
Decade-long field measurements and modelling show that projected ocean temperatures could restrict cell division rates of an important marine cyanobacterium.

MASST searches billions of spectra in seconds, answering the question, "Where have I seen this molecule before?" in the same time it takes to ask it. Custom MASST databases tailor searches to your research questions.
